Titre du poste : Groundsperson

Entreprise : University of Glasgow

Description du poste : Please note, this vacancy is open to current University of Glasgow employees onlyJob PurposeThe role holder will be responsible for maintaining, preparing and delivering a year-round programme of maintenance and renovation to the outdoor facilities and surrounding areas, at Garscube Sports Complex. They will maintain the excellent UofG facilities and equipment while sustaining a safe and welcoming environment.Main Duties and ResponsibilitiesMaintain a multi-sports complex and deliver an outstanding customer experience by applying knowledge and experience in delivering playing surfaces for all level of users.Responsible for arboriculture and horticulture and renovating natural grass pitch surfaces and nurturing seedlings through stressful periods, and implement corrective measures to control and protect.Carry out soil analysis and calibrate materials to undertake grounds work throughout the year, contributing to best value and improved sustainability.Create and develop work schedules and renovations programme.Erect and dismantle sports equipment for team use and carry out maintenance checks and the reporting of faults.Clear and treat snow and ice during inclement weather to ensure that the paths and roads are accessible to prevent disruption to University of Glasgow Sport’s business continuity.Carry out an environmental assessment prior to applying chemicals or fertilisers to limit damage caused by misuse, drift, or faulty machinery to always ensure safe application to protect the environment plants insect’s species, animals, and persons.Assist in co-ordination with emergency services, customers and Duty Managers in the event of an emergency incidentKnowledge, Qualifications, Skills and ExperienceKnowledge/QualificationsEssential:A1 Ability to demonstrate the competencies required to undertake the duties associated with this level of post having acquired the necessary knowledge and skills in a similar role.A2 Understanding of environmental considerations, sustainability and surrounding eco-system.A3 Hold current PA1 & PA6 certification for chemical spraying.A4 Hold current LANTRA qualifications for pruning and chipping.A5 Knowledge and understanding of repair practices to natural grass pitch surfaces before and after game time/training sessions or events to ensure optimum recovery.A6 Experience in green keeping and fine turf management.A7 Full current and clean Driving License.A8 Knowledge and understanding of safe working practices, including manual handling and implementation of risk assessment corrective measures.A9 First Aid at Work Qualification (or ability to attain within 6 months of employment)A10 IOSH Working Safely (or ability to attain within 12 months of employment).Desirable:B1 NVQ Level 2 Grounds Maintenance and Horticulture or equivalent.B2 Good knowledge and demonstrable experience of artificial sports surfaces.SkillsEssential:C1 Confident and adaptive communicator with interpersonal skills and the ability to respond positively to enquires, using own initiative to resolve issues providing an excellent customer experience.C2 Ability to work to changing priorities unsupervised and deal with customer queries effectively.C3 Ability to work effectively as part of a team.C4 Time management skills with the ability to organise workload and prioritise appropriatelyC5 Ability to take initiative and innovate within the agreed dimensions and duties of the role.ExperienceEssential:E1 Experience of working in an outdoor sports facility/golf course environment.E2 Experience of operating, manoeuvring and maintaining a wide variety of mechanical grounds maintenance equipment (ranging from tractor mounted equipment to pedestrian).Desirable:F1 Experience of learning new techniques and craft practices in line with evolving technology and legislative Health and Safety requirements.Terms and ConditionsSalary will be Grade 4, £23,881 – £26,338 per annum.This post is full time and open ended.Closing Date: 23:45 29th May 2025As a valued member of our team, you can expect:1 A warm welcoming and engaging organisational culture, where your talents are developed and nurtured, and success is celebrated and shared.2 An excellent employment package with generous terms and conditions including 41 days of leave for full time staff, pension – pensions handbook https://www.gla.ac.uk/myglasgow/payandpensions/pensions/, benefits and discount packages.3 A flexible approach to working.4 A commitment to support your health and wellbeing, including a free 6-month UofG Sport membership for all new staff joining the University https://www.gla.ac.uk/myglasgow/staff/healthwellbeing/.We believe that we can only reach our full potential through the talents of all.
